You may see surfers entering the surf directly into a rip, an experiencedCurrent surfer who wishes to surf the back breaking waves can use the rip to be pulled out. It is the quickest and easist way to get out into the line-up.

Remember, you are a beginner, until your confidence and surf awareness skill increases, conditions closer to the beach will most likely be more suited to your ability level, you should stay within your limits and avoid rips but look forward to their assistance as you improve.


Currents run parrallel with the beach, they can be quite strong and can
drag you some distance if you are not aware of them. Before entering the
surf identify a marker on the beach and take notice of how far away from
that marker you have moved during your surf.
